Yeah, I honestly think there's merit to critical reception as a way of spotlighting something you might otherwise not give the time of day to (because 24 hours in a day isn't enough), but stan wars always distort them and only bring them up when they can be used to validate their opinion (see also: chart positions, sales, streams, views, followers, post engagements, everything). Ariana's metacritic score is very impressive sure, but how many people boasting that will also listen to Architects' album from just 3 months ago which has a slightly higher metacritic score. If metal core isn't your scene, too bad, the meta-score dictates it's essential listening. It's all just a symptom of musical opinions being highly subjective and based on emotions & pre-conceptions. All these metrics are the only manner of objective fact that can be used to dispel the haters. There's also a weird misconception that people believe telling someone their opinion is wrong, and directing them to the 'right' opinion will ever sway them. I have never, ever seen someone say they got into a band because someone told them that the band they like sucks and that they should listen to this band instead. Doing something like that just makes people revel in going against you.
